Subtract 27/40 from 5/20
5/20 - 27/40 is -17/40.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 20 and 40 is 40
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 40 - For the 1st fraction, since 20 × 2 = 40,
5/20 = 5 × 2/20 × 2 = 10/40 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 1 = 40,
27/40 = 27 × 1/40 × 1 = 27/40 - Subtract the two like fractions:
10/40 - 27/40 = 10 - 27/40 = -17/40
